Hormonal Imbalance

Some women will experience at some point in their monthly cycle what is known as “menstrual headache”. This is characterised by throbing pain on one side of the head accompanied by a feeling of nausea and slight body tempreture. Depending on what time in the cycle this occurs, this type of headache  indicates that ovulation  has commenced if this occurs mid-way in the cycle .Otherwise it heralds the onset of a new cycle.  Women who are on birth control pills tend to experience this more than others and have been known to be more prone to developing uterine fibroids and cysts. The key issue here is increasing pelvic circulation. By taking some doses of Vitamin E ,few days before the onset of a period usually helps. Some women have done better by adding magnesium for support due to the possible deficiency of this mineral during  such times.

Muscle tension and emotional stress.

Believe it or not, nothing more triggers tension headaches than emotional stress.People who work to meet official deadlines, workaholics who cannot draw the line between work and rest, or those who are under emotional stress in their relationships are major sufferers of tension headaches. This is characterised by tightness in the head, high pressure pain on both sides of the head , shoulders and neck. A relaxing massage over the neck and shoulders followed by two to three  eight ounce glasses of water usually bring quick relief.

Migrane headache.

This could mimic a sinus condition or even an elevated blood pressure caused by constricted arteries, but a doctor should be able to tell the difference.Migrane headaches  are characterised by throbbing pain on both sides of the head, accompanied by sensitivity to light and sometimes sound.Many things may trigger a migrane, including food allergy, chemical imbalances resulting in certain mineral defficiences,troubled nerve in the head and  poor circulation to the brain. Low blood sugar (hypoglycemia)

If you have ever had headaches accompanied by dizziness, lack of concentration, blurry vision and low energy especially when you are hungry, you  may be experiencing low blood sugar. As soon as you eat something, energy is  restored and all those horrible feelings subside.When people are hypoglycemic and not diabetic, they tend to believe that they have the better of a bad disease.Low blood sugar should raise as much concern as high blood sugar just as low blood pressure is as bad as high blood pressure.Functional deficiencies in both the liver and pancreas must be addressed in this condition. Milk thistle, dandelion and chromium picolinate are helpful . A good multivitamin/mineral supplement also help. Snacking  between meals to balance sugar levels and increasing nuts and vegetables in the diet is highly recomended by experts.

High blood pressure

Hypertensive patients are well too familiar with headaches accompanied by pain in the eye, neck and jawbone. Some of these symptoms may not be  common with some patients ,that is why heart disease is called the silent killer. Wherever  these symptoms prevail,it is usually due to the narrowing of blood vessels  and  the formation of plaque .
